When to Visit Windsor

Seasons that shape Windsor's rhythm.

May draws many travelers to Windsor for the Royal Windsor Horse Show and longer daylight on the riverfront.

Spring

Spring brings a steadier footfall to the town center, with brighter daylight on the shopfronts, castle approaches, and riverside paths. The pace feels outward-looking, shaped by day trips, garden visits, and unhurried walks between cafés and historic streets.

Highlights

Royal Windsor Horse Show, Windsor Castle State Apartments, walks through Windsor Great Park

Tip

Spring suits travelers who want landmark visits and open-air wandering before the summer calendar fills.

Summer

Summer gives Windsor a longer, later rhythm, with people lingering around the center after dinner and making the most of evenings along the river. The streets feel social and easy to navigate, with a steady flow between pubs, shops, and evening events.

Highlights

Royal Windsor Racecourse summer meetings, walks along the River Thames, changing of the guard at Windsor Castle

Tip

Summer is a good fit if you like full days, late evenings, and a relaxed city-center pace.

Fall

Fall settles the town into a more measured tempo, with crisp mornings for castle visits and quieter stretches along the main streets. The light softens early, and the focus shifts toward concerts, galleries, and slower meals in the center.

Highlights

Windsor Festival, Windsor Castle autumn visits, riverside walks

Tip

Fall suits travelers who prefer a calmer schedule and a more reflective city break.

Winter

Winter brings a polished, compact feel to Windsor, where the center is easy to take in on foot between indoor attractions, cafés, and early evening dinners. The atmosphere leans formal and composed, with a steady rhythm around the castle and town streets.

Highlights

Christmas at Windsor Castle, Windsor on Ice, New Year celebrations in the town center

Tip

Winter works well for travelers who want museum time, festive displays, and shorter, more concentrated days out.

Annual events worth planning around

Royal Windsor Horse Show

A major equestrian gathering each May, with show jumping, dressage, and carriage driving.

Windsor Festival

A long-running arts program each September and October, centered on music, talks, and performance.

Windsor Christmas Market

A seasonal market in late November and December, bringing stalls, lights, and festive shopping.

Windsor Great Park Illuminated

An after-dark winter light trail in November and December, set along walks through the park.

Is Windsor walkable, or will I need a car?

Windsor is easy to explore on foot if you plan to stay near the center. Many of the main streets, shops, dining spots, and riverside paths are within a comfortable walking radius, while a car is more useful for wider day trips than for getting around town. If you prefer to keep plans simple, choose a stay close to the areas you expect to visit most.

When is Windsor likely to be busiest?

Windsor tends to feel busiest around weekends, school breaks, and holiday periods, especially in the most central areas. If you prefer a quieter stay, consider arriving midweek or choosing dates outside peak travel times. Exact crowd levels can vary by season and by what is happening locally, so it is worth checking your timing before you book.
